IO-Link – What is it?
IO-Link is the first standardised IO technology worldwide (IEC 61131-9) for the communication with sensors and also actuators.
It is typically used in an automation environment below the I/O level for individual linking of field devices
It uses point-to-point communication based on the long established 3-wire sensor and actuator connection without additional requirements regarding cabling.
IO-Link is not a fieldbus, nor is it a replacement for AS-i. It is however evidence of the further development of the existing, tried-and-tested connection technology for sensors and actuators.
Since 2010, IO-Link has been incorporated within the PROFIBUS & PROFINET User Organisation (PNO)
IO-Link is an independent sensor/actuator interface solution for use with several industrial fieldbus and industrial network solutions, including PROFIBUS and PROFINET. Use bladder accumulators & io link devices to improve hydraulic system performance
1. Use Bladder Accumulators & IO-link Devices to
Improve Hydraulic System Performance
Flexible hydro-pneumatic accumulators with a steel pressure tank are filled with nitrogen.
Bladder accumulators create the ideal fluid pressure by mixing gas with stored hydraulic fluid.
Accumulators hold a quantity of liquid that can be re-fed into the hydraulic pump as needed
under this pressure. This equipment is being replaced in a variety of sectors, resulting in
increased flow restrictions.
IO-Link is a common interface that is used to communicate with sensors and actuators all around
the world. IO-Link communication, which is based on a three-wire connection, provides for the
transmission of three types of data: process data, service information, and events.
2. What are the Benefits of IO-Link Commutation Devices?
Universally Used – IO-Link has been internationally standardised, making it global and
interchangeable. M12 connectors are used in most I/O-Link devices, and they can be used
with no restrictions when it comes to switching and communicating.
A smart device – The IO-Link technology is sophisticated and has a lot of features. It comes
with quick and efficient transmission capability so, at every cycle, 2 bytes of process data
are available. The automatic saving of device parameter data enables its characteristics
to be automatically transferred to save time and effort when a previously used device is
connected.
Recognisable devices – This device description can be found on all io-Link devices (IODD).
This description file contains information of the manufacturer, functionality, and other
key facts that can be read and processed quickly, allowing devices to be identified swiftly.
